AvailableLily is a young female British Shorthair and Domestic Short Hair mix with a medium build and a short coat patterned in brown and gray tabby. At about 8 months old, she is spayed, vaccinated, and house trained. Lily lives in Columbus, OH and would thrive in a gentle, loving environment where she can continue to come out of her shell.
About Lily
Lily’s story starts with resilience. She was abandoned at a Columbus apartment complex as a kitten and left to face winter alone. Struggling to survive, she kept to herself, dodging dangers and scraping by until a kind neighbor started feeding and watching over her. Even as a kitten, Lily had to hide from dogs and wildlife, never knowing a safe place to rest. By the time spring arrived, Lily—still very young—was pregnant and gave birth in a shed near the apartments, caring for her kittens against all odds. When her trusted neighbor realized Lily had no home, she connected Lily and her kittens with a foster parent. In her foster home, Lily slowly began to relax. She’s gentle, quiet, and learns a little more every day about letting down her guard. Lily needs a patient person ready to let her blossom and finally be cared for and cherished. She gets along with other cats and children, but might take time to open up in new situations. What type of living environment is this breed usually best suited for?
Lily, a mix of British Shorthair and Domestic Short Hair, tends to do well in calm, stable homes. These cats adapt to apartments or houses as long as they have safe, cozy places to relax.
How much outdoor space does this breed typically need?
Lily doesn't need outdoor space; British Shorthair and Domestic Short Hair mixes do perfectly well as indoor cats, where they're protected from dangers and have comfortable spots to perch.
Is this breed typically suitable for homes with children?
Yes, Lily's breed mix is known for being gentle and tolerant with children. She herself is reported to get along with kids, making her a nice fit for family homes.
